Can my 10 month old Hermans eat these?

I've posted your photos below. The plant in the pot is a Hibiscus (Hibiscus moscheutos) and is perfectly fine to feed to your tortoise (and he will particularly like the flowers). Here are links to the two entries we have for hardy hibiscus:

The other plant is a Prickly Lettuce and is not good to feed to tortoise. Here is our entry for it:
